Senior Category Specialist - Fencing | Mortenson
Mortenson is currently seeking a Senior Category Specialist I – Fencing that will be responsible for estimating, procurement, and project management of assigned material categories. The role involves managing various project phases, developing sourcing strategies, and maintaining relationships with key suppliers to ensure financial success and material cost reductions.

Responsibilities
Manage Design Phase, Estimating, and Procurement for Key Projects
Estimating and Procurement
Interpret project plans, specifications, and details for estimate preparation
Solicit quotes from manufacturers and trade partners
Understand project specifications and qualify manufacturer quotes
Create Proposals
Assist Design Phase with material selections based on client needs
Create and Maintain procurement log
Manage Submittals and Shop Drawing process
Coordinate with project teams and other trades
Identify and engage with internal stakeholders across engineering and operations to capture category requirements
Assess potential opportunities for categories including spend segmentation, category maturity, cost drivers, and supply market analysis
Develop Sourcing Strategy for categories detailing projects, sourcing levers, timing, resources, and expected benefits
Adapt the strategy as business, market, and economic environments change
Support Annual Category Reviews including updated projects, metrics, strategy, and risk mitigation strategies
Maintain relationship with suppliers at the appropriate level
Support in the development of supplier business reviews
Monitor supplier’s quality and delivery performance
Leverage supplier relationship to assist buyers with expedites as needed
Assist with the development of strategies to achieve financial and category initiative goals
Assist with the development of pricing strategies for project proposals
Assist with monthly and annual category financial reviews with project information, metrics, forecast and strategy, if applicable
Assist in supplier contract negotiations
Aid in developing negotiation strategy including supplier profiles, commercial negotiations targets, defining switching costs, and building Total Cost of Ownership (TCO)
Closely monitor market drivers affecting the category including raw material pricing and availability, supplier capacity, industry disruptions and new products
Responsible for forecasting, reporting, mitigating, and recovery of commodity inflation
Effectively work and build relationships with those of diverse backgrounds and organizational levels
Lead team members by example, offer effective coaching and feedback, and effectively manage performance
